You Have:
  • 5+ years of experience with Oracle HCM Cloud, including Core HR and an additional module such as Absence, Benefits, Talent, or Payroll
  • Experience configuring HCM business processes, workflows, approvals, and functional setups
  • Experience providing Tier 2 or Tier 3 HCM production support, including troubleshooting issues and coordinating with technical teams such as Integration, DBA, or Security
  • Knowledge of HR operations and data structures, including worker records, assignments, roles, and security
  • Knowledge of Oracle HCM reporting tools such as OTBI and BI Publisher
  • Secret clearance
  • Bachelor's degree in Management Information Systems, Information Technology, Computer Science, Mathematics, Business, Engineering, or Physical Science

Nice If You Have:
  • Experience across multiple Oracle HCM Cloud modules such as Talent Management, Compensation, Benefits, Payroll, OTL, or Recruiting
  • Experience with HCM integrations, including HDL/FBL, HCM Extracts, REST or SOAP APIs, and integration platforms such as OIC, Dell Boomi, or MuleSoft
  • Experience supporting quarterly Oracle Cloud updates, regression testing, issue resolution, and release management
  • Knowledge of security architecture, including roles, privileges, data security, and audit considerations within Oracle HCM
  • Oracle HCM Cloud Certifications such as Core HR, Talent, Absence, Benefits, Compensation, Payroll, or OTL Certification

Booz Allen Hamilton is a leading provider of management and technology consulting services to the US government in defense, intelligence, and civil markets. Headquartered in McLean, Virginia, the firm also serves major corporations, institutions, and not-for-profit organizations. Founded in 1914 by Edwin G. Booz, the company has a long-standing tradition of helping clients achieve success by delivering a wide range of consulting services that include strategic planning, human capital and learning, communication, systems development, and others. The company's mission is to empower people to change the world, and it has a reputation for maintaining the highest standards of integrity and-excellence.
